Transaction 0859dcbc5d7148c050bb20ffc21202a239e74b8cb85c0afdb80049e9219acf65
1 Input
2 Outputs
- 0859dcbc5d7148c050bb20ffc21202a239e74b8cb85c0afdb80049e9219acf65:0
- 0859dcbc5d7148c050bb20ffc21202a239e74b8cb85c0afdb80049e9219acf65:1
value 432972
address 3NGrTJqmnc8soagyuFfNBvnnsBFFSKBRfz
value 904119
address 16DsbMQ33z7WVnSTZ758Qc8hmdQKPJJTp4